WebJul 16, 2024 · The way it works is this: the hotel sets aside a number of rooms (usually 10), gives the block a code (usually your names), a set price (sometimes discounted), and a deadline to book the rooms by (usually around a month before the wedding). Guests can call the hotel, give the room block name, and reserve a room using their own credit card.

The perk of a room block is that they save you time, money and ensure that all of your … WebSep 19, 2024 · Attrition rates vary, but, per Ayers, they typically hover around 80 percent. For a requested block of 50 rooms, that would mean your party would be required to fill 40. If your party only fills 35, you, as the creator of the block, would be required to pay for the remaining five rooms.

A courtesy block is when the hotel holds a set number of rooms for you at no additional charge. You aren’t financially liable for the unused rooms. However, after a certain date, those rooms are released for other travelers to book. Make a note on your calendar of the cutoff date for your room block. One to two weeks prior, contact the hotel and ask for a copy of your rooming list. If you have the time and energy, you can send an email reminder to any guests who haven’t booked. florabel medication from mexico
